New Estimate Suggests Samsung Approaching 10 Million Gear VRs Sold By 2018

UploadVR Between Realities podcast

The manufacturers have released only limited data points — with Samsung coming out with the largest number to date revealing the technology giant sold 5 million Gear VRs through the beginning of the year. The firm projects the overall mobile VR king this year will be Samsung approaching 10 million units total.
